Chandigarh, November 21

Advertisement

The State Vigilance Bureau (SVB), Haryana, has caught Alokpanth, Estate Officer, and Naseer, Rent Collector, of Waqf Board, Rohtak, red-handed while accepting a bribe of Rs 50,000.

Advertisement

A bureau spokesman said that Harish Kumar, a resident of Meham, submitted a complaint to the Vigilance Bureau that he had applied for taking a 220 sq yard plot on rent under the Waqf Board.

Advertisement

Initially, these officials demanded bribe of Rs 1.6 lakh but after negotiation, the deal was struck for Rs 50,000.

On receiving the complaint, a criminal case was registered. The team of Vigilance Bureau carried out a raid and caught accused Naseer and Alokpanth red-handed in the presence of Duty Magistrate Suresh Chander, Naib Tehsildar, Rohtak. Both the accused were produced in court. — TNS
